Transaction 27a7df630148cb25cf26e1c9fb30d3a99cef141394232d6f36f1e32171ea2c61
1 Input
1 Output
-
27a7df630148cb25cf26e1c9fb30d3a99cef141394232d6f36f1e32171ea2c61:0
- value
- 150961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e84d09fa977830d5de1ceae93a11dd77f9603df OP_EQUAL
- address
- 3EgayvjSDemgrtQH6LZp3WkNcH894RaE8w